How to Become a Confident Singer

  1. Learn to breathe properly so that your breath is constantly and consistently supporting your singing voice.
  2. Get your posture right so that your legs, hips, back and abs are supporting you.
  3. Open your mouth wider, particularly on the high notes, and project your voice as much as possible.

How to Develop Your Stage Presence

  1. Be free to tell your story on stage. When you walk onto a stage, it’s about being vulnerable.
  2. Develop a unique image.
  3. Be aware of your body and breathing.
  4. Connect with the audience.
  5. Be passionate about your playing.

Why are some singers shy?

Believe it or not but one of the reasons why some singers are actually shy is because they are not used to hear their own voice while singing. The most probable cause for this is that they are used to sing only in front of the mirror and not actually recording themselves sing.

How do you spot a shy person singing duets?

The problem with shy people, in general, is that you can spot them from a mile away. Most of them even while walking will keep their head down, while they are singing they’re looking anywhere but the audience, and when they have to sing a duett they will avoid any eye contact with the other singer.
